Analysis of Marine Heat Waves by JXP and others

Primary code base is to generate and analyze the entities known as Marine Heat Wave Systems (MHWS).

See (Prochaska, Beaulieu, & Giamalaki 2023, Environmental Research Climate)[https://iopscience.iop.org/article/10.1088/2752-5295/accd0e]
